Answer:

The value of [tex]f(g(2))[/tex] is 0

Step-by-step explanation:

Given:

[tex]f(x) = x^2-2[/tex] and [tex]g(x) = \sqrt{x}[/tex]

we have to find the [tex]f(g(2))[/tex].

first find [tex]g(2)[/tex]

Put x =2 in g(x) we have;

[tex]g(2) = \sqrt{2}[/tex]

Now;

[tex]f(g(2))=f(\sqrt{2})=(\sqrt{2})^2-2 = 2-2 = 0[/tex]

Therefore, the value of [tex]f(g(2))[/tex] is 0
